Latest Patents: Vino Mathew's recent patents are noteworthy for their innovative approaches. The first patent is for a "Motor Degradation Identification System and Methods Using Multiple Environmental Factors." This system includes modules that compare operating parameters with predetermined thresholds, set indicators based on comparisons, and ultimately indicate whether an electric motor is degraded. This invention can enhance the reliability and performance monitoring of electric motors.
Another significant patent is for a "Transmission Output Speed Based Wheel Flare Control System for Electrified Vehicle Applications." This control system is designed for vehicles and includes a wheel slip control loop and a wheel flare control loop, enabling dynamic control based on wheel speed and transmission output speed. This innovation promises to improve vehicle stability and efficiency, particularly in electrified vehicle applications.
